Judoka Distria Krasniqi defeated the Japanese Funa Tonaki in the final, securing the first medal for this year and the second for Kosovo, since her debut at the 2016 Olympic Games.
"Kosovo wins! We have the first Olympic medal from the Tokyo 2020 Olympic Games. Distria Krasniqi brought gold to himself and our entire country, making us proud. " - writes the Kosovo Olympic Committee.
The President of Kosovo, Vjosa Osmani, who was present in the hall, described the moment as "indescribable honor and happiness".
"Distria, the first in the world, proved today again that it is invincible and that it is the pride of our country. "She proved that talent and work always triumph." - writes Osmani.

This is the second Olympic medal for Kosovo, after Majlinda Kelmendi's gold in Rio 2016.
